      Meaning of the first name
      Veliko

      Origin 
      Slavic, Particularly Serbian And Croatian

      Meaning 
      Great or Large in Slavic Languages

      Variations 
      Velika, Velibor, Velik

      The name Veliko has its origins in Slavic language, specifically deriving from Serbian and Croatian roots. In these languages, veliko translates to great or large. This name embodies notions of significance, strength, and magnitude, qualities that are often celebrated in cultural contexts. Its use as a name can denote a sense of pride and importance, aligning with the linguistic emphasis on size and greatness.

      Historically, the name Veliko has been associated with various figures and events in Slavic culture. It has been used in naming places, such as towns and geographical landmarks, often to convey a sense of prominence or notable features. The term has also found its way into folklore, where it may denote heroes or larger-than-life characters who exemplify great deeds. Over time, the name has maintained its cultural resonance while evolving in its usage across different regions and periods.

      In contemporary times, Veliko continues to be used in both personal and place names within Slavic countries, retaining its original meaning. The name may be found among individuals as a first name and is sometimes used in a more informal context to express admiration or affection. Additionally, Veliko appears in various cultural references, from literature to local businesses, exemplifying its lasting impact and relevance in modern Slavic society. Its enduring presence highlights both the historical significance and the ongoing appreciation for the qualities it represents.
